Free parking for West Woods nature reserve
West Woods Car Park, on an unnamed lane northeast of Marlborough (SN8), provides 30 grass-reinforced bays for forest visitors. Open daily from 6 am to 9 pm (extended hours in summer), parking is free, courtesy of the Forestry Commission. The site has no lighting to preserve the woodland environment, so visitors are advised to arrive during daylight. A gravel footpath leads directly into West Woods, renowned for bluebell displays in spring. There are no disabled bays or EV charging facilities, as the remote rural location lacks grid connections. The car park is unstaffed, but informal surveillance is maintained by park rangers patrolling the area. It is approximately a 5-minute walk to the main trailhead, making it a popular starting point for nature walks and mountain biking.
